Modular Robotics Shift from Capex Projects to SLA Insurance
O’Neill Logistics deployed 24 Robust.AI Carter robots at its 1 million-square-foot Savannah campus to cut travel time, raise picker productivity, and absorb order spikes without reworking the floor. At the same time, UNIT AI raised $12 million to scale modular “Physical AI” for fulfillment and reverse logistics, pitching installs in about 1,000 square feet, go-lives in roughly a week, and pay-per-use economics aimed at sub-12-month ROI. UPS said 68.5% of its U.S. package volume is already automated, while FedEx expanded robotic trailer-loading and unloading pilots in one of parcel’s most labor- and safety-intensive tasks.
These moves show automation shifting from large, fixed programs to modular, task-specific systems sold as fast-deploy productivity tools. The buying case is no longer warehouse redesign; it is protecting service levels in live operations under labor pressure, especially where walking time, dock handling, inventory accuracy, and returns processing create bottlenecks.
For operators, automation is becoming an SLA and resilience decision. For vendors and investors, the winning products are those that prove rapid deployment, small footprint, and measurable throughput or labor gains in existing sites.

Warehouse Automation Moves Into End-to-End Goods Handling
BAUHAUS and Renault this week pushed warehouse automation beyond narrow pilot picking cells into production-scale goods handling. BAUHAUS deployed XYZ Robotics’ RockyOne and RockyOne SE at its Krefeld central warehouse to automate goods receiving: unloading shipping containers, identifying cartons, sorting them, and building mixed-SKU shelf-ready pallets with barcode scanning and palletization software. The system uses computer vision at receiving, but public evidence does not show item-level piece-pick extending into putaway or replenishment.
Renault scaled Exotec automation at its Villeroy spare-parts platform, where 191 Skypod robots now support goods-to-person piece-pick across roughly 20,000 SKUs, with 14 picking stations and 2 replenishment stations. Reported order processing time fell from 120 minutes to 15–20 minutes, with throughput of about 4,000–5,000 order lines per hour using roughly 14 operators.
Together, these deployments show the market shifting from isolated robot cells to a broader goods-handling automation layer spanning inbound receiving, palletization, and high-mix fulfillment. Competitive advantage is moving toward platform breadth, workflow integration, and the ability to manage mixed-SKU flow across multiple processes, not just peak pick rate.

Warehouse Automation Is Consolidating Into Full-Stack Platforms
AIP’s reported $1 billion warehouse automation platform is being assembled through consolidation, not a new product launch. Reporting indicates AIP is combining Honeywell’s Warehouse and Workflow Solutions assets, especially Intelligrated and Transnorm, with AIP-owned Trew to create a broader business spanning systems integration, conveyor and sortation, robotics, AS/RS, palletizing, controls, and lifecycle services. Secondary reports also point to goods-to-person robotics and voice-picking capabilities. The mix matters: Intelligrated and Transnorm bring established material-handling and sortation scale, while Trew adds controls, engineering, and integration depth.
The strategic shift is away from point products and toward full-stack procurement. Instead of selling isolated subsystems into partner-led projects, the combined platform is being positioned to own more of the design, controls, implementation, and aftermarket stack under one umbrella. That raises the bar for narrower vendors, where advantage now depends on breadth, integration accountability, and service coverage as much as hardware differentiation. For operators, the upside is simpler sourcing and lower integration risk; the tradeoff is deeper dependence on fewer scaled vendors. For vendors and investors, value is moving toward platforms that can bundle equipment, software, controls, and lifecycle support into one enterprise sale and one long-term service relationship.
